ATM

Website
475 Arch St
New Britain, CT 06051

Located in the vibrant city of New Britain, CT, ATM stands as a crucial link in the world of financial transactions. Embracing its role as a full-service debit payments network, ATM, also known as STAR, ensures seamless access for purchases and payments across various platforms. By prioritizing consumer satisfaction, ATM goes above and beyond to deliver safe and flexible debit transactions, utilizing cutting-edge technologies like digital wallets, ATMs, and point-of-sale systems.

With a commitment to innovation and reliability, ATM caters to the diverse needs of its clientele, offering convenient and secure payment solutions. Whether it's a quick transaction at an ATM or a purchase through a digital wallet, ATM's dedication to enhancing the consumer experience shines through. In the heart of New Britain, CT, ATM stands as a pillar of efficiency and trust in the ever-evolving landscape of financial services.

Generated using this brand's available information

Own this business?
See a problem?

You might also like

Partial Data by Infogroup (c) 2025. All rights reserved.

Partial Data by Foursquare.